From fbe604d88396db5214008a784061b501a9a93445 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Daniel Black Date: Tue, 14 Nov 2023 10:01:08 +1100 Subject: [PATCH] MDEV-32795: ALTER SEQUENCE IF NOT EXISTS non_existing_seq Errors rather than note Like all IF NOT EXISTS syntax, a Note should be generated. The original commit of Seqeuences cleared the IF NOT EXISTS part in the sql/sql_yacc.yy with lex->create_info.init(). Without this bit set there was no way it could do anything other than error. To remedy this removal, the sql_yacc.yy components have been minimised as they where all set at the beginning of the ALTER. This way the opt_if_not_exists correctly set the IF_EXISTS flag.
